Collection: Dhar
Tile Size: 8.78″ x 8.78″
Tile Coverage: 6.99 sq. ft./box
Thickness: 9 mm
Finish: Matte
Material: Porcelain

Country of Origin: Spain

Use: Commercial/Residential
Usage: Wall/Floor
Indoor/Outdoor: Both
Chemical Resistant: Yes
Frost Resistance: Yes
MOHS (Scratch Resistant): 5
PEI Rating: 4
Rectified: No
Shade Variation: V2

Sold by the Box: 13 Tiles/Box

Description

The Dhar collection translates the visual language of raw stone into a streamlined porcelain format, combining natural irregularity with technical precision. Its surface reveals layered veining, tonal variation, and soft directional movement that mimics the erosion and mineral buildup found in quarried rock. The result is a tile that feels grounded and architectural, offering a sense of permanence without sacrificing design flexibility.

This collection is suited for environments where material integrity and visual depth are priorities—open-plan living spaces, spa-inspired bathrooms, or commercial lobbies. Its surface texture is calibrated for slip resistance while maintaining a refined, non-reflective finish. The pattern variation across pieces enhances the authenticity, allowing installations to achieve a more natural, unstructured appearance without compromising performance.

Dhar works well alongside both muted and bold materials, making it a reliable option for layered interiors that explore contrast or harmony. It brings a sense of scale and quiet drama, especially in large-format layouts where the subtle flow of the design becomes more pronounced. This collection offers an effective solution for those looking to bring the presence of natural stone into high-traffic or moisture-prone areas, where durability, consistency, and ease of maintenance are just as important as visual impact.
